[Python-checkins] CVS: python/dist/src/Python sysmodule.c,2.98.6.2,2.98.6.3

Neal Norwitz nnorwitz@users.sourceforge.net
2002年3月03日 07:17:09 -0800


Update of /cvsroot/python/python/dist/src/Python
In directory usw-pr-cvs1:/tmp/cvs-serv8134/Python
Modified Files:
 Tag: release22-maint
	sysmodule.c 
Log Message:
SF #506611, fix sys.setprofile(), sys.settrace() core dumps
when no arguments are passed
Index: sysmodule.c
===================================================================
RCS file: /cvsroot/python/python/dist/src/Python/sysmodule.c,v
retrieving revision 2.98.6.2
retrieving revision 2.98.6.3
diff -C2 -d -r2.98.6.2 -r2.98.6.3
*** sysmodule.c	6 Feb 2002 17:06:03 -0000	2.98.6.2
--- sysmodule.c	3 Mar 2002 15:17:07 -0000	2.98.6.3
***************
*** 565,572 ****
 	 setdlopenflags_doc},
 #endif
! 	{"setprofile",	sys_setprofile, METH_OLDARGS, setprofile_doc},
 	{"setrecursionlimit", sys_setrecursionlimit, METH_VARARGS,
 	 setrecursionlimit_doc},
! 	{"settrace",	sys_settrace, METH_OLDARGS, settrace_doc},
 	{NULL,		NULL}		/* sentinel */
 };
--- 565,572 ----
 	 setdlopenflags_doc},
 #endif
! 	{"setprofile",	sys_setprofile, METH_O, setprofile_doc},
 	{"setrecursionlimit", sys_setrecursionlimit, METH_VARARGS,
 	 setrecursionlimit_doc},
! 	{"settrace",	sys_settrace, METH_O, settrace_doc},
 	{NULL,		NULL}		/* sentinel */
 };

AltStyle によって変換されたページ (->オリジナル) /